1. Understanding the Basics: Lotion vs. Cream

First things first, what makes lotion and cream different? Lotion is typically lighter and absorbs quickly, making it perfect for those with oily or combination skin. It’s like a refreshing breeze on a hot summer day – light, airy, and easy to apply. On the other hand, cream is richer and more emollient, providing a deeper layer of moisture that’s ideal for dry or mature skin. Think of it as a warm hug from your favorite blanket on a chilly evening. 🧥

2. Ingredients and Texture: The Key Differences

The texture and ingredients of lotion and cream play a crucial role in their effectiveness. Lotions often contain water as a base ingredient, which helps them absorb quickly without leaving a greasy residue. They’re packed with humectants like glycerin to draw moisture into the skin. Creams, however, use oils and butters to create a thicker consistency, locking in moisture and forming a protective barrier on the skin. This makes them perfect for intense hydration and nourishment. 🌞

3. Choosing the Right Moisturizer for Your Skin Type

So, how do you pick the right one? If you have oily or acne-prone skin, opt for a lightweight lotion to keep your pores clear and avoid excess oiliness. For dry or sensitive skin, a rich cream will provide the deep hydration you need to maintain a healthy, glowing complexion. Combination skin? Consider using a lotion on your T-zone and a cream on your cheeks for balanced hydration. Remember, it’s all about finding the perfect balance for your unique skin needs. 💆‍♀️✨
